      Cloth. Zustand: Near Fine. Zustand des Schutzumschlags: Good. First edition. A first edition, first issue copy of Wharton's novella, adapted into the critically acclaimed play by Zoe Akins. A first edition, first issue copy, with no mention of the Pulitzer Prize to the dust wrapper spine. Bound in original publisher's cloth, with original pictorial dust wrapper, clipped, but original price still present. The adaptation of Edith Wharton's 1924 novella The Old Maid. Wharton was a prolific and critically acclaimed literary voice, and wrote novels informed by her upper-class New York peers. This play and novel was made into a 1939 film adaptation starring Bette Davis. This work contains the story in its adapted form, by American playwright, poet and author Zoe Akins. The play won the Pulitzer Prize for Drama in 1935. From the collection of South African writer, film and theatre critic Clive Hirschhorn. Hirschhorn is also a collector of first edition 20th century works, and also holds a collection of film and theatre merchandise. Bound in original blue cloth.       Vintage reference photograph from the set of the 1993 film, showing Martin Scorsese directing actor Daniel Day-Lewis between takes. Annotations in manuscript ink on the verso, identifying subjects in the photograph. Based on the 1920 novel by Edith Wharton, about a wealthy lawyer who begins to fall in love with his fiancée's cousin, a scandalously divorced countess. Nominated for four Academy Awards, winning one. Set in New York, and shot on location in Troy, New York.
